The authors explore the discursive origins of the self, the problem of agency and social understanding of personality. In the process, they elevate the emotions to a significant place in our understanding of mind, action and being. The theoretical breadth of the book is matched by its treatment of a wide range of subjects, including: consciousness; the brain; perception; thought; personality; and the emotions.

Cet ouvrage pluridisciplinaire est destiné à accompagner l'enseignement des sciences humaines et sociales au sein des études médicales et des études en santé, de la formation initiale aux Masters et à la formation professionnelle continue. Il s'adresse aux étudiants et à tous ceux qui s'engagent dans les métiers du soin ou qui s'intéressent aux questions épistémologiques, éthiques et sociales impliquées par la médecine contemporaine. Il est principalement l'émanation du Collège des humanités médicales, fondé en 2008, qui réunit les enseignants chercheurs en charge de cet enseignement en France, avec le concours de spécialistes des thématiques abordées.

This volume is the outcome of 25 years of research into the neurolinguistic aspects of bilingualism. In addition to reviewing the world literature and providing a state-of-the-art account, including a critical assessment of the bilingual neuroimaging studies, it proposes a set of hypotheses about the representation, organization and processing of two or more languages in one brain. It investigates the impact of the various manners of acquisition and use of each language on the extent of involvement of basic cerebral functional mechanisms. The effects of pathology as a means to understanding the normal functioning of verbal communication processes in the bilingual and multilingual brain are explored and compared with data from neuroimaging studies. In addition to its obvious research benefits, the clinical and social reasons for assessment of bilingual aphasia with a measuring instrument that is linguistically and culturally equivalent in each of a patient's languages are stressed. The relationship between language and thought in bilinguals is examined in the light of evidence from pathology. The proposed linguistic theory of bilingualism integrates a neurofunctional model (the components of verbal communication and their relationships: implicit linguistic competence, metalinguistic knowledge, pragmatics, and motivation) and a set of hypotheses about language processing (neurofunctional modularity, the activation threshold, the language/cognition distinction, and the direct access hypothesis).

Learning is becoming an urgent topic. Nations worry about the learning of their citizens, companies about the learning of their workers, schools about the learning of their students. But it is not always easy to think about how to foster learning in innovative ways. This book presents a framework for doing that, with a social theory of learning that is ground-breaking yet accessible, with profound implications not only for research, but also for all those who have to foster learning as part of their responsibilites at work, at home, at school.

[Français] La réglementation des données médicales est aujourdhui un thème majeur du droit médical et du droit des nouvelles technologies. Limportance du sujet provient de lexploitation croissante des technologies de linformation et de la communication dans le secteur des soins de santé et des risques nouveaux que cela entraîne pour les droits et libertés des citoyens. Les contributeurs au présent ouvrage ont été sélectionnés en vue de fournir une approche multidisciplinaire de haut niveau de la matière. Réunies, leurs contributions donnent une vision globale des défis à résoudre dans les années futures afin dassurer la protection des citoyens au regard des traitements de données médicales.[English] The regulation of the processing of medical data is a major topic of discussion in Medical Law and in IT Law. Its significance results from the intensive use of information and communication technologies in healthcare and from the new threats their use creates to the rights and freedoms of citizens. The contributors were selected in order to yield a multidisciplinary approach. Together their contributions provide a global vision of the challenges to be addressed in the next few years as to ensure the protection of citizens regarding the processing of medical data.

Antisocial acts by children and teens are on the rise – from verbal abuse to physical bullying to cyber-threats to weapons in schools. Strictly punitive responses to aggressive behavior may even escalate a situation, leaving peers, parents, and teachers feeling helpless. This unique volume conceptualizes aggression as a symptom of underlying behavioral and emotional problems and examines the psychology of perpetrators and the power dynamics that foster intentionally hurtful behavior in young people. It details for readers how bibliotherapy offers relevant, innovative, and flexible treatment – as a standalone intervention or as a preventive method in conjunction with other forms of treatment – and can be implemented with individuals and groups, parents, teachers, and even rivals. Treating Child and Adolescent Aggression Through Bibliotherapy: Offers research-based guidelines for treating aggression in children and adolescents. Provides an integrative approach to treating aggressive children and youth to more fully address the complex nature of antisocial behavior. Sets out a practical framework for bibliotherapy, choosing developmentally appropriate materials, identifying themes for discussion, matching selections to therapeutic progress, and more. Demonstrates individual and group bibliotherapy sessions with male and female children and adolescents. Includes a complete session-by-session prevention program for the classroom. Features an appendix of suggestions for effective therapeutic literature.
